Read more– opens a dialog boxEach review score is between 1–10. To get the overall score that you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of review scores we’ve received. We're currently testing a weighted review system in Malta and Iceland (excluding hotel and vacation rental chains). For properties in these countries, the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. In addition, guests can give separate "subscores" in crucial areas, such as location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value for money, and free Wifi. Note that guests submit their subscores and their over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.

United KingdomThere were a lot of stairs for my elderly parents to navigate and the stairwell lighting was poor for someone with bad eyesight (and it didn’t come on until you were halfway down). And the twin beds were a bit odd - one was higher up than the other making it accessible for only one of our party which meant we had to organise ourselves differently to use the rooms. Not the end of the world but some photos in the advert would have made that clearer, I think only the double is shown. Parking was limited. We found a spot every day but often it was the only spot available so we we lucky - during peak season I wouldn’t want to have a car there!
Beautiful hotel in a great location at edge of old town. Very nicely done up, clean, tranquil, amazing bougainvillea plants everywhere. We had a lovely view across the rooftops from the balcony. Breakfast was also great, another wonderful setting, with small changes every day to sample different greek foods. If you are vegetarian just remember to explain in advance and ask that your food is on different plates if you don’t want cheese touching meat. Kitchenette was well stocked for our minimal needs (crockery, knives etc.). Washing machine provided too. We were able to leave our bags for a few hours after check out and before departing the city. Day trips to Heraklion-Knossos and to the south were very easy from here - the drive over the hills was fantastic.

CanadaSomething you should know if you come by car, and no reflection on the property, is that there is no parking in the Old Town. The streets are too narrow so coming back from a day trip meant finding a parking space, which was a lottery as everyone who lives in the Old Town needs to park overnight. Infact the place is close to options around the stadium which was good, especially for luggage transfer.
An oasis within Old Rethymno, this was a lovely old courtyarded property that had been restored, maintaining all the rustic charm but with the modern touches and facilities you need on vacation. The location was good, close to parking options with a grocery around the corner and only a short walk to more bars, restaurants and shops, and of course the fortress and waterfront. We came in late March, so the pool and breakfast weren't up and running, but we really enjoyed our time in this property. Our room had a balcony over the street with a sea view and a roof terrace.

United KingdomAlthough as it is is in a side street there is no car park; but there are free public car parks within 5-10 mins walk of the hotel which are simple to find as long as you know to look for the bus station and football pitch.
We have stayed in the old Town many times so we knew where we were located even though we have never stayed there before. Although the hotel is split between 2 properties this was no issue as our apartment had plenty of space with a separate bedroom to the living/kitchen area and a bathroom and it was just a 1 minute walk across the street to the other part of the hotel (pool is there and breakfast is served there). There was plenty of light from the windows and we had two balconies, one at the front over looking the street and the other internally to the courtyard. The kitchenette is really convenient and the bonus was the little top loading washing machine! Decor was clean and modern probably the best space we've had in all the visits to the area. Great location for the Old Town, Fortezza, bus station, out door market and pick up points for trips.

United KingdomWhilst you can discern from the website pictures its size, the swimming pool is really very small and can only take 1 or 2 people sensibly. The pool area is, however, very quiet and sunloungers are provided for relaxation. Parking can be a problem, especially on market days(Saturdays and Thursdays), and there is a walk of about 30 metres from the nearest parking spots, all of which are on-street. Note that the beach which is about 10-15 minutes walk away is not sand and you cannot swim there, although the adjacent harbour area is very pleasant.
Location great for accessing the old town, its restaurants and sites. A corner shop at the end of the street could be used for small items with a larger supermarket about 10 minutes walk away. The breakfasts were really good with different dishes served directly to your veranda table every day. Each dish was prepared fresh that morning and generally included an egg/omelette dish, some fruit or yoghurt as well as cake and tea/coffee . Irini the hostess was really helpful and spoke very good English. Suite 2 is good in hot weather as it is stone built staying cool across the day.
